What is Norwegian Krone (NOK)

The Norwegian Krone (NOK) is the official currency of Norway, a country known for its stunning fjords, rich natural resources, and strong economy. Introduced in 1875, the krone is abbreviated as "NOK" and is symbolized by "kr." One krone is subdivided into 100 øre, though coins no longer circulate. The value of the krone is influenced by various factors, including oil prices, interest rates, and economic indicators.

Norway’s economy is characterized by a robust welfare system, substantial oil exports, and a focus on renewable energy. As a result, the Norwegian krone tends to be relatively stable in the foreign exchange market compared to many other currencies. However, it can experience fluctuations based on global oil prices, as Norway is a significant oil producer.

What is Colombian Peso (COP)

The Colombian Peso (COP) is the official currency of Colombia, a vibrant country known for its rich culture and diverse landscapes. The peso has been the currency since 1810 and is represented with the abbreviation "COP" and the symbol "$". Like many currencies, the peso is subdivided into smaller units, with 100 centavos making up one peso.

Colombia's economy is varied and includes sectors such as agriculture, mining, and manufacturing. The country has been working on economic reforms to stabilize its currency and promote growth. The COP is affected by various economic factors, including inflation rates, interest rates, and trade balances.
